Boat rental marketplace, Borrow A Boat, has raised more than a million pounds through a crowdfunding campaign on Seedrs.
The U.K-based company set out to raise £750,000 but surpassed that target in 24 hours with the total currently standing at more than £1.1 million.
Borrow A Boat, which launched in 2017, previously raised £1.1 million via a crowdfunding campaign on CrowdCube last November.
The company has made several acquisitions in recent months including Amsterdam-based peer-to-peer boating marketplace Barqo and U.K.-based accommodation provider Beds on Board in early March 2022.
Borrow A Boat, which was set up to make boating more accessible, affordable and flexible, is one of a number of new entrants looking to take a slice of the global charter market that is estimated to be worth $30 billion by 2027.
The company says it is planning a public listing in 2023.

Matt Ovenden, founder and CEO of Borrow A Boat, says: “We are living through a revolution in marketplaces, and believe this should extend to the boating world. Renting a boat should be as easy as booking a hotel, flight or train.
"We, as a business, have made huge strides forward in the last six months – continually smashing our all-time sales records month-on-month towards the end of 2021 and we’re now, in 2022, consistently clearing one million a month in revenue.
"This Seedrs fundraise will help fuel our continued growth, with expansion into new countries – Italy, France, Germany and Spain – which we hope to complete by the end of the year. We will also be investing in tech enhancements – substantial UI, UX and automation operator plans in order to keep up with our fast-growing business revenues."
